The yearly Global Power 150 - Women in Staffing List recognizes the 100 most influential females in the Americas, and 50 additional ladies globally. Buffy Stultz White, president of Workforce Solutions and Services and Marisa Zaharoff, MSN, RN, president of Nurse and Allied Operations, were both featured on the publication's 2019 list. White is accountable for leading sales, financial efficiency and customer service of CCH brand names that make up nursing, allied and labor force solutions. With more than 25 years of experience in the staffing industry, White brings a broad variety of strategic and tactical understanding in consumer advancement, tactical sourcing, process engineering, company process enhancement, modification management and dynamic group structure. Her deep knowledge in creating, developing and handling high performance, high-growth organizations serves her well in supplying tactical direction across numerous brands. CCH is the third-largest health care staffing company in the US.

Zaharoff is accountable for the strategic direction, organization and operational performance of business in her function as president of Nurse and Allied Operations. She brings more than twenty years of quality enhancement, sales, functional and branch management experience to CCH. Zaharoff is likewise a Registered Nurse. Under her leadership, the business's daily department, Cross Country Medical Staffing Network, has leapt to the top 5 of SIA's list of biggest per diem nursing firms in the US with seven percent market share.

Cross Country Healthcare is a nationwide leader in offering innovative health care labor force options and staffing services. Our options take advantage of our more than thirty years of competence and insight to help clients in solving complex labor-related challenges while maintaining high quality results. We are committed to hiring and positioning highly certified health care professionals in practically every specialty and area of proficiency. Our varied customer base includes both medical and nonclinical settings, servicing acute care health centers, doctor practice groups, outpatient and ambulatory-care centers, nursing centers, both public schools and charter schools, rehab and sports medicine centers, federal government facilities, and homecare. Through our nationwide staffing teams and network of 65 workplace areas, we are able to place clinicians on travel and per diem projects, regional short-term contracts and long-term positions. We are a market leader in providing flexible labor force management solutions, which include managed services programs (MSP), internal resource pool consulting and advancement, electronic medical record (EMR) shift staffing, recruitment procedure outsourcing, predictive modeling and other outsourcing and consultative services. In addition, we offer both maintained and contingent placement services for healthcare executives, physicians, and other healthcare professionals.
